Question

If the weight of an angle A ( = 48°22'40'') is 4, then the weight of the angle (A2=24°1120′′) will be ________
  1. 16

Open in App
Solution

The correct option is A 16
If a quantity of given weight is divided by a factor, the weight of the result is obtained by multiplying the given weight by the square of that factor.
Angle 'A' has weight = 4
Weight of A2=4×(2)2=16
